Loading...

Find Jobs

Showing 2284 jobs

October 25, 2025 by
Technical Resources
October 25, 2025 by
Spire Healthcare
October 25, 2025 by
Quilter
October 25, 2025 by
PPM Recruitment
October 25, 2025 by
EMCOR
October 25, 2025 by
University of Southampton
October 25, 2025 by
The Works Stores
October 25, 2025 by
Academics
October 25, 2025 by
NHS